So yeah, I was about to drive my girl home, so I reverse my car, then I started to hear this noise, similar to driving over a plastic bottle or something. So I went forward and the noise went away. I pulled a U Turn and saw that there was no bottle. I think nothing of it because as I was driving off, I did not hear the noise again.

As I dropped her off, her house is on a small incline by the way, so my car rolled back a bit before I left. The noise came back, I was like WTF.

I went home, check underneath my car, and guess what? One of my Under Panel is falling off. It is the one that is usually taken off when changing oil. Freaking Toyota!!

So now I am driving with 1 less Under Panel thumbsdown
